Output 4aab02abfe6fc121a098f8ddabfd2b77445db6b9b68c1a5acb8a2d3ae94de1a6:1

value
41760306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a3fe15c012e7125c2af4dc8d0ea088fdb7d6710 OP_EQUAL
address
345p21iLTodzrpYuPizkB6kEUsHcuotrTB
transaction
4aab02abfe6fc121a098f8ddabfd2b77445db6b9b68c1a5acb8a2d3ae94de1a6
confirmations
326945
spent
true